Apricot Nut Benefits: What Does the Evidence Show?
Apricot nut benefits are not supported by strong clinical evidence. The term usually refers to the apricot kernel, the seed inside the hard stone at the center of the fruit. While kernels contain some fat, protein, fiber and plant compounds, there is no reliable evidence that eating them improves overall health, prevents cancer or treats a medical condition.
Interest in apricot kernels often relates to amygdalin, a natural substance present in kernels and other stone-fruit seeds. Amygdalin has been promoted under the name “laetrile” or “vitamin B17,” although it is not a vitamin. When swallowed, amygdalin can be broken down in the body and release cyanide, a poison that interferes with cells’ ability to use oxygen. This potential harm is the most important consideration when evaluating apricot kernel products.
Eating the apricot fruit itself is different. Fresh or dried apricots can be part of a balanced diet and provide fiber, potassium and carotenoid pigments. The nutritional value of the fruit does not mean that its kernel is safe or beneficial as a supplement.
Why Bitter and Sweet Kernels Are Not the Same
Apricot kernels are commonly described as bitter or sweet. Bitter kernels generally contain much more amygdalin than sweet varieties, and therefore have greater potential to release cyanide. However, appearance, taste and product labeling do not reliably indicate how much amygdalin a particular kernel contains. Levels can vary by apricot variety, growing conditions and processing methods.
Sweet kernels are sometimes used in small quantities as a flavoring ingredient in baked goods, confectionery and traditional dishes. This culinary use does not establish a medicinal benefit, and it should not be assumed that sweet kernels are risk-free in large amounts or in concentrated oils, powders, extracts or capsules. Processing may lower cyanide-related compounds in some foods, but the effect differs between products.
For practical safety, bitter kernels should not be eaten as snacks or used as home remedies. Products marketed as raw kernels, apricot seed extract, amygdalin or laetrile may be especially concerning because the amount consumed can be difficult to control.
Claims About Cancer and Other Conditions
Some advertisements claim that apricot kernels, amygdalin or laetrile can prevent or cure cancer. These claims are not supported by well-designed clinical research. Major cancer organizations and medicines regulators have warned that laetrile is not an approved cancer treatment and can cause cyanide poisoning, including severe and potentially life-threatening illness.
Laboratory research can sometimes show that a compound affects cells in a test tube. This does not prove that it is effective or safe for people. Human cancer treatment decisions require evidence from carefully conducted clinical trials that examine benefits, side effects, suitable dosing and interactions with other treatments. That level of evidence is not available for apricot kernels or laetrile.
People living with cancer may understandably seek every possible option. However, replacing, delaying or changing evidence-based care in favor of kernel products can be harmful. A cancer specialist can discuss supportive approaches that are compatible with a person’s diagnosis and treatment plan, including nutrition, symptom control and emotional support.
Potential Risks and Signs of Cyanide Poisoning
The main risk from apricot kernels is cyanide exposure. Cyanide can be released as amygdalin is digested, especially after consuming bitter kernels or products made from them. The amount released is unpredictable, so there is no dependable home method for deciding how many kernels are safe to eat.
Symptoms of cyanide poisoning may begin soon after ingestion and can include headache, dizziness, nausea, vomiting, stomach pain, unusual weakness, confusion, a fast heartbeat and shortness of breath. Severe poisoning may lead to low blood pressure, seizures, loss of consciousness or cardiac and breathing failure. Symptoms can progress quickly, so a person should not wait for them to settle if poisoning is possible.
Risk may be higher when kernels are eaten crushed, chewed or ground, as this can make amygdalin more available for digestion. Taking vitamin C alongside apricot kernel or amygdalin products has also been associated with increased cyanide exposure. Alcohol and certain dietary practices may affect metabolism as well, but they do not make these products safe.
- Do not use bitter apricot kernels as a daily supplement or cancer remedy.
- Keep kernels and supplements away from children.
- Avoid combining kernel products with vitamin C supplements unless a qualified clinician has specifically advised otherwise.
- Seek urgent help after suspected ingestion if symptoms develop.
Who Should Avoid Apricot Kernel Products?
Children should not eat apricot kernels or take products containing amygdalin. Their smaller body size can make a given exposure more dangerous, and serious poisoning has been reported after children consumed only small amounts. Kernels should be stored securely, as they may be mistaken for edible nuts or sweets.
Pregnant or breastfeeding people should avoid apricot kernel supplements because safety has not been established and cyanide exposure could pose risks to both parent and baby. People with liver, kidney, lung or heart conditions should also avoid these products unless their clinician has reviewed the specific product and their medical history.
Anyone receiving chemotherapy, radiotherapy, targeted therapy, immunotherapy or other prescribed medication should discuss supplements with their treating team before using them. “Natural” does not always mean safe, and supplements may introduce toxic effects, interfere with nutrition or complicate assessment of treatment-related symptoms.
Safer Nutrition Choices and Self-Care
For most people, the safest way to enjoy apricots is to eat the fruit rather than the kernel. Fresh apricots, dried apricots without excessive added sugar, and unsweetened apricot products can contribute variety to a diet that includes vegetables, fruits, whole grains, legumes, protein foods and healthy fats. Portion size is especially relevant with dried fruit because it is more concentrated in calories and natural sugars.
There is no single food that prevents cancer or replaces medical treatment. Health is better supported by consistent habits such as avoiding tobacco, limiting alcohol, maintaining regular physical activity when possible, obtaining recommended vaccinations and attending appropriate screening appointments. A registered dietitian can offer individualized advice for people with diabetes, kidney disease, digestive symptoms or cancer-related nutrition concerns.
People who have already eaten a small amount of a kernel and feel well should avoid eating more. They can contact a local poison center, pharmacist or healthcare professional for guidance based on the product, amount, timing and any symptoms. Bringing the package or product label to a medical visit can help clinicians assess potential exposure.
When to Seek Medical Care
Urgent medical care is needed if a person develops dizziness, severe headache, vomiting, confusion, fainting, difficulty breathing, chest discomfort, seizures or marked weakness after eating apricot kernels or taking an amygdalin-containing product. Emergency services or a local poison center should be contacted immediately. A person with possible poisoning should not drive themselves to care.
Medical advice is also appropriate for anyone who has been regularly using apricot kernel supplements, even without symptoms. A clinician can review possible risks, current medications and any need for assessment. People with cancer should speak with their oncology team before starting or continuing any alternative product marketed as an anticancer treatment.

Frequently asked questions
Are apricot nuts good for health?
Apricot kernels have not been shown to provide proven health benefits in clinical studies. The apricot fruit can be a nutritious part of a balanced diet, but this does not make the kernel a necessary or beneficial supplement. Bitter kernels can be unsafe because they may release cyanide.
Can apricot kernels cure cancer?
No. There is no reliable clinical evidence that apricot kernels, amygdalin or laetrile cure, prevent or control cancer. Using them instead of proven cancer treatment may delay care and expose a person to cyanide poisoning.
What is amygdalin in apricot kernels?
Amygdalin is a naturally occurring compound found in apricot kernels and some other plant seeds. During digestion, it can break down and release cyanide. It is sometimes marketed as laetrile or “vitamin B17,” but it is not a vitamin.
How many bitter apricot kernels are safe to eat?
There is no reliable number that can be considered safe for bitter apricot kernels. Amygdalin levels vary substantially between kernels, so the cyanide exposure cannot be predicted by counting them. Avoiding bitter kernels and amygdalin supplements is the safest approach.
What should someone do after eating apricot kernels?
They should not eat any more and should monitor for symptoms such as nausea, dizziness, weakness, headache or breathing difficulty. If symptoms occur, or if a child has eaten kernels, contact emergency services or a poison center promptly. A healthcare professional can give advice based on the amount eaten and the specific product.
Are sweet apricot kernels safer than bitter kernels?
Sweet kernels generally contain less amygdalin than bitter kernels, but amounts can vary and large or concentrated intakes are not recommended. Their occasional culinary use is different from taking kernels as a supplement or remedy. They should not be used to treat cancer or other medical conditions.
